Understanding the Core Functionality of a Lab Casino
At its heart, a lab casino functions as a controlled environment designed to simulate the atmosphere of a real casino, but with a crucial difference: the emphasis on research and the testing of new systems. Unlike a commercial casino focused primarily on profit, a lab casino’s primary objective is data collection and analysis. This includes tracking player behavior, evaluating the performance of new game designs, and assessing the effectiveness of responsible gambling measures. The data gleaned from these observations provides invaluable insights for game developers, regulators, and responsible gambling organizations.
The types of games offered within a lab casino are often diverse, ranging from traditional table games like blackjack and roulette to the latest slot machine innovations and interactive gaming experiences. Participants are often recruited from a varied demographic to ensure a representative sample for research purposes. Data collection methods can include eye-tracking technology, biometric sensors, and detailed questionnaires, all aimed at understanding the psychological and behavioral factors influencing gambling behavior. The purpose is not simply to observe what players do, but why they do it.

Responsible Gambling Initiatives within the Lab Casino Environment
A key function of lab casinos is the testing and refinement of responsible gambling initiatives. These facilities provide a safe and controlled space to evaluate the effectiveness of various tools and strategies aimed at preventing problem gambling. This includes features such as self-exclusion programs, spending limits, time limits, and reality checks – reminders that inform players how long they’ve been playing and how much they’ve spent. By observing how players interact with these tools, researchers can identify areas for improvement and develop more effective interventions.
The insights gained from lab casino research are crucial for informing regulatory policies and industry best practices. For example, studies conducted in these environments can help determine the optimal timing and messaging for responsible gambling prompts. They can also reveal which types of players are most vulnerable to problem gambling and tailor interventions accordingly. The focus is always on creating a more sustainable and ethical gaming ecosystem.
Evaluating the Effectiveness of Player Protection Tools
One important area of research focuses on the usability and effectiveness of player protection tools. Researchers assess how easily players can access and understand these tools, as well as whether they actually use them when they need them. For example, they might investigate whether a self-exclusion program is effective if it's difficult to enroll in or if players are unaware of its existence. This process helps refine the design and implementation of these tools to make them more accessible and user-friendly.
Furthermore, lab casinos can test the impact of different responsible gambling messages on player behavior. Do certain types of messages encourage players to gamble more responsibly, or do they have the opposite effect? By carefully analyzing player responses to different messages, researchers can develop more effective communication strategies. The ultimate goal is to empower players to make informed decisions about their gambling habits.

Analyzing Player Behavior to Optimize Game Mechanics
A key aspect of game design testing is analyzing player behavior. Researchers track a variety of metrics, such as win rates, bet sizes, and game duration, to understand how players are interacting with the game. This data can reveal patterns and trends that might not be apparent through traditional methods. For example, researchers might discover that players consistently avoid a particular feature or that they tend to abandon the game after a certain number of losses.
This information can then be used to make targeted improvements to the game’s design. Perhaps the problematic feature needs to be simplified or removed altogether. Or maybe the game needs to be rebalanced to reduce volatility and make it more appealing to a wider range of players. The goal is to create a game that is both challenging and rewarding, providing players with a positive and engaging experience.

Applying Lab Casino Insights to Real-World Gaming Platforms
The findings emerging from lab casino research aren’t confined to those controlled environments. A crucial step involves translating these insights into practical improvements for standard online and physical casinos. This process often entails working with gaming operators to implement new responsible gambling tools, refine game designs, and update player protection policies. The challenge lies in adapting findings from a focused setting to the dynamic and complex realities of a live casino environment. Successful implementation requires careful planning, thorough training of staff, and continuous monitoring to ensure effectiveness.
One recent example involved the application of eye-tracking data from a lab casino to optimize the placement of responsible gambling messages on an online gaming platform. Researchers discovered that players were more likely to notice and respond to messages when they were positioned in the peripheral vision. By strategically placing these messages, the platform was able to significantly increase player engagement with responsible gambling resources, demonstrating the tangible benefits of lab casino research.
